GitLab Flow 사용
-컨벤션
# 제목
[스택] 타입 : 제목 (#이슈번호)
# 스택 : FE, BE, DevOps
# 타입 : feat(기능 추가), fix(버그 수정), design(UI 수정), docs(문서 수정)
# 본문(구체적인 내용) 작성
- 변경 내용 : 내용
####################################
# 예시
[FE] feat: 로그인 화면 추가 (#1)
- 변경 내용 1 : login component 추가
- 변경 내용 2 : datepick component 추가
-커밋 매뉴얼
gitLab에서 issue - new issue
description에서 템플릿 선택하기
주석에 따라 제목 쓰기, 기능 설명, 참고 사항 채우기
자기한테 할당하기
create issue
브랜치 구조
브랜치 만들어 이동하기
git checkout -b '브랜치 이름'
예시 : git checkout -b FE/addDirectory
각 feature브랜치 이름
FE/기능명
BE/기능명
EM/기능명/이니셜
대소문자 주의! 오류 나면 .git 내의 폴더와 브랜치명 일치하는지 확인하기
이미 있는 브랜치로 이동하기
git checkout '브랜치 이름'
예시 : git checkout FE/addDirectory
브랜치 업데이트하고 코딩 시작하기
git fetch origin develop
git merge origin/develop